Before shipping Pinecrest 5.0, migrate the deep-link router. The old Trailhook scheme is removed; all links must resolve through the universal-link handler. Remove legacy scheme entries from both app manifests. Run the link-verification job against the staging domain and confirm zero unresolved routes. If any marketing links still use the old scheme, coordinate redirects with the Foxglove team before release. Do not ship with mixed routing enabled. After migration, the router must run with exactly these values.

settings of fawip-yadug:
[druath]
port = 3000
region = north-4
host = druath.qirvanworks.corp
timeout_ms = 1500
retries = 1

**Onboarding note: landlord site audit**

Heads up — our landlord, Merrowgate Estates, runs a site audit of Calloway Wharf every quarter. Their assessors walk the floors checking fire exits, signage, and desk density, so keep corridors clear that week. The facilities desk hosts them, logs their visit, and walks them through the plant rooms. They'll ask to see the riser cupboards on levels 2 and 4, which stay locked. To let the assessors in, punch in the door-pass code shown below.

staff pass of haduf-yagaf = bdg-DBSQF-1

Handover for the Cressley dedupe pipeline. Matching runs nightly; fuzzy-name merges are gated behind a review queue, so plugin authors should never merge records directly — emit candidates instead. The scoring thresholds changed last sprint after the Dunmore tenant complained about over-merging, so don't trust old docs. Plugins resolve behaviour from the service config at startup, and the current production values are as follows.

settings of fafog-haduf:
ZORIX_PIN=4648
ZORIX_METRICS_HOST=metrics.zorix.paliqsys.corp
ZORIX_LOG_LEVEL=info
ZORIX_TENANT=druix

### Account Recovery — Per-Tenant Rate Quotas

When restoring a Fernwhistle tenant admin account, quotas reset to the default tier. Verify the tenant's contracted rate limits before re-enabling API traffic, then reapply any custom quota overrides from the quota ledger. The ledger console requires recovery authentication. Enter the passphrase below.

recovery phrase for fawif-tajeg: norael-aldmir-casir-brivan-ulaion